Title: Idaho Crime Victimization Survey 2008

Summary: The 2008 Idaho Crime Victimization Survey (ICVS) was conducted between March to May 2009. Survey participants were randomly selected from either a landline or a cell -phone sampling frame. Total participants included 2,664 landline and 565 cell-phone households. Participants were asked about any instances of property crime, violent crime, stalking, sexual assault, and domestic violence occurring in 2008. In addition, respondents were questioned regarding personal perceptions of neighborhood safety and satisfaction with police services. The 2008 ICVS survey enhances knowledge of crime and victimization in Idaho and assists in evaluating satisfaction with and effectiveness of criminal justice and health service programs. The report provides a summary of findings from the 2008 ICVS.
